P. Facchi, D. Lonigro
Journal of Physics A: Mathematical and Theoretical 57 (2024), 015302.
Abstract. The survival probability of a quantum system with a finite ground energy is known to decay subexponentially at large times. Here we show that, under the same assumption, the average value of any quantum observable, whenever well-defined, cannot converge exponentially to an extremal value of the spectrum of the observable. Large-time deviations from the exponential decay are therefore a general feature of quantum systems. As a simple application of these results, we show that, when considering an open quantum system whose dynamics is generated by a Hamiltonian with a finite ground energy, a large-time exponential decay of populations is forbidden, whereas coherences may still decay exponentially.
